Low washer fluid level warning indicator
This warning light indicates the
washer fluid reservoir is near empty.
Refill the washer fluid as soon as
possible.Malfunction indicator (if equipped)
This indicator light is part of the Engine Control System which moni-
tors various emission control system
components. If this light illuminates
while driving, it indicates that a
potential problem has been detected
somewhere in the emission controlsystem. This light will also illuminate when
the ignition switch is turned to the
ON position, and will go out in a few
seconds after the engine is started. If
it illuminates while driving, or doesnot illuminate when the ignition
switch is turned to the ON position,
take your vehicle to your nearest
authorized KIA dealer and have the
system checked.
Generally, your vehicle will continue
to be drivable and will not need tow-
ing, but have the system checked by
an authorized Kia Dealer as soon as
possible.

Armed stage
The Theft-Alarm system is armedas follows
After all doors, engine hood, and trunk are locked, press the “LOCK”
button on the transmitter once.The hazard flasher lights will flash
once when the button is pressed,
then twice when the button is
released. (At this time, the alarmdoes not sound.) Alarm stage
The alarm will be activated when:
Any door or trunk lid is opened
without using the key or the trans-
mitter.
The engine hood is opened. The siren will sound and the hazard
warning lights will blink continuously
for 27 seconds (for Europe, Middle
East Area), and repeat the alarm 3
times unless the system is disarmed
(except Europe, Middle East Area).
To turn off the system, unlock the
doors with the transmitter. Withheld alarm
When the alarm is armed, the alarm
will not sound if the trunk lid is
opened with either the key or the
transmitter.
However, if the trunk lid is not opened completely within 30 sec-
onds after unlocking with the trans-
mitter, or if any of the doors or hood
is opened while the trunk lid is open
and the alarm armed, the alarm willsound.

EMERGENCY COMMODITY (IF EQUIPPED)
There are some emergency com-
modities in the vehicle to help yourespond to the emergency situation. Fire extinguisher
The fire extinguisher is located in the
trunk.
If there is small fire and you know
how to use the fire extinguisher, take
the following steps carefully.
1. Pull the pin at the top of the extin-
guisher that keeps the handle from being accidentally pressed.
2. Aim the nozzle toward the base of the fire.
3. Stand approximately 2.5 m (8 ft) away from the fire and squeeze
the handle to discharge the extin-
guisher. If you release the handle,
the discharge will stop.
4. Sweep the nozzle back and forth at the base of the fire. After the fire
appears to be out, watch it careful-
ly since it may re-ignite. First aid kit There are some items such as scis-
sors, bandage and adhesive tape
and etc. in the kit to give first aid toan injured person.
Triangle reflector
Place the triangle reflector on the
road to warn oncoming vehicles dur-
ing emergencies, such as when the
vehicle is parked by the roadside due
to any problems.

Interior lights bulb replace- ment
1. Using a flat-blade screwdriver,gently pry the lens from the interi- or light housing.
2. Remove the bulb by pulling it straight out.
3. Install a new bulb in the socket.
4. Align the lens tabs with the interior light housing notches and snap
the lens into place.
CAUTION
Prior to working on the Interior
Lights, ensure that the “OFF”button is depressed to avoid burning your fingers or receiv-ing an electric shock.
